Transaction: 852568222939444aaad14829a35c7632778d52f70e1f258d507ea6dca08ce592

Block Hash: af4e8274b022a32947eb8e8b1891ee3dbcb7394a2539a6b69c9bdfb42ff3d6d8

Confirmations: 23826

Timestamp: 2025-11-18 17:14:24

Amount: 21.345162000000002

Is Block Reward: No

Inputs

Sender Address Amount
SfXmfUeeBg8bcRpJ52t7S7nhqS7qZGmuSN 21.28

Outputs

Recipient Address Amount
SfXmfUeeBg8bcRpJ52t7S7nhqS7qZGmuSN 21.345162000000002